Analyst: Google releases Gemini 3.5 speech transcription model, with accuracy ranking in the top five
2026-08-27 12:09:15
According to CoinMeta, Google has released the Gemini 3.5 speech transcription model, which is currently the most accurate speech transcription model offered by Google. For the first time, a smart mode has been incorporated into a dedicated transcription model. This model is available in both real-time and recorded transcription versions, with the real-time version now open for public testing. Based on evaluations, the WER (word error rate) for non-streaming transcription is 2.6%, while for the real-time version, it is 4.0%. The smart mode can automatically remove catchphrases and organize spoken text into paragraphs, lists, dates, and numbers. The model supports over 85 languages and allows for the addition of custom professional vocabulary. The cost of recorded transcription is approximately $0.005 per minute, and the real-time version costs about $0.009 per minute. This model has already been used in Google Translate's Rambler and macOS versions, and will be integrated into the Chrome in the future.
